Separation of the evaluation part
This issues tracks the work towards a more modular design, where the evaluation happens outside of the Array and can choose different targets (e.g. opencl, cuda etc.)
This issues tracks the work towards a more modular design, where the evaluation happens outside of the Array and can choose different targets (e.g. opencl, cuda etc.)